Join Professor Terry Gudaitis for a session focused on what to do during your undergraduate career so you stand out when applying for employment in the intelligence community.  She will discuss GPA, extracurricular and co-curricular involvement opportunities, and what to do if you don’t get hired by your desired agency right away.

 

Professor Gudaitis is the Director of the Intelligence Studies Program.  She has worked as a CIA operations officer and behavioral profiler, and is the owner/CEO of Mindstar Security & Profiling, LLC.
